Overview

7 antenna structures are registered with the FCC in Aubrey, TX.

The register works out to 1.64 structures per square mile here.

At a median of 76 m (249 ft), structures here run 0.5% taller than the Texas median of 76 m (248 ft).

The mix here is 3 monopoles, 1 guyed mast — the rest of the register is made up of rooftops, water tanks and structures the FCC records without a specific type.

The oldest structure on file here was registered in 1983, the newest in 2025 — 42 years of build-out visible in one register.

Tallest registered structures

Height Type Built Owner ASR
318 m (1,044 ft) Guyed tower 2002 Sba Towers Xi, LLC 2627534
105 m (343 ft) Tower 1983 Central States Microwave Transmission CORP 614998
79 m (260 ft) Tower 1997 Stc Five LLC 108076
76 m (249 ft) Tower 2000 Sba 2012 Tc Assets, LLC 2606798
60 m (198 ft) Monopole 2011 Sba Towers IV, LLC 2678282
59 m (195 ft) Monopole 2025 Cityswitch II, LLC 2729465
39 m (129 ft) Monopole 2021 Tillman Infrastructure, LLC 2718806

About this data

Figures are drawn from the FCC's public antenna structure register (2026-08-23). It covers structures that need registering — broadly those over 200 feet or close to an airport — and not the many shorter installations that carry mobile traffic.

"Owner" is the entity that registered the structure, usually a tower company such as American Tower or Crown Castle. It does not indicate which carriers operate equipment on the structure.
